Former Little Mix star Jesy Nelson has issued a heartfelt plea for help after her car was stolen from her Essex driveway in the early hours of Sunday morning. The black Land Rover Defender, which contained essential medical equipment for her 11-month-old twins, Ocean Jade and Story Monroe Nelson-Foster, was taken from her home in Brentwood around 3 am.Jesy Nelson - All the latest news and gossip - The Sun

The twins, who were born prematurely in May 2025, are battling spinal muscular atrophy type 1 (SMA1), a devastating condition that causes progressive muscle wasting and threatens their ability to walk or even regain neck strength. The car held critical hospital equipment necessary for their care, making the theft even more heartbreaking for Jesy.

Jesy, 34, turned to her social media followers for help, offering a £10,000 reward for any information leading to the car’s recovery. In an emotional Instagram story, she shared: “My car got stolen off my driveway in the early hours of this morning. If anyone sees a black Defender reg plate JJ73SSY, please DM me or contact the police.
